About Gradescope AI

Gradescope is an AI-assisted grading platform designed for educators to streamline assessment workflows for both online and in-class assignments. It offers features like dynamic rubrics, AI-powered grading assistance, code autograders, and bubble sheet scanning. Pricing starts at $1 per student per course for the Basic plan, with institutional pricing available.

Gradescope is a paper-to-digital grading platform that helps educators administer and grade assessments more efficiently. The tool uses AI to assist with grading workflows, including template-based comparison that overlays student work to identify differences, automated code grading, and bubble sheet processing. It provides dynamic rubrics, assignment statistics, regrade request management, and grade export capabilities. Used by institutions including Purdue University, Oregon State University, and University of Washington, Gradescope is owned by Turnitin and offers both individual instructor plans and institutional licensing options.

Pros & cons

Pros

  • AI helper compares student work to templates by overlaying files, showing differences and grouping similar answers for efficient grading
  • Supports multiple assessment types including code assignments with autograders, bubble sheet exams, and handwritten submissions
  • Provides assignment statistics, regrade request management, and full grade export capabilities for comprehensive assessment tracking
  • Used by major educational institutions including Purdue University, Oregon State University, and University of Washington

Cons

  • Grading breakdowns are only as helpful as the information entered by instructors; insufficient explanations can make point assignments confusing
  • Occasional upload issues reported by users when submitting assignments
  • Biases can stem from outdated or unbalanced training data, affecting grading reliability especially in controversial or complex subjects
  • Institutional pricing model is opaque and requires contacting sales team rather than transparent self-serve pricing

Frequently asked questions

Is Gradescope AI free?+

Gradescope offers a free Basic plan with limited features including dynamic rubrics and assignment statistics. After an institutional trial ends, instructors can continue using the Basic plan at no cost. However, advanced features like AI-powered grading and code autograders require paid plans starting at $1-3 per student per course.
